Overview

High-capacity high-performance sealed force sensor

The force sensors of the 3200 series offer a performance level equivalent to the 1200 series, with the added benefit of a fully hermetic stainless steel construction. The design of the 3200 series sensors is the result of 50 years of continuous improvement. The selection of strain gauges, construction, manufacturing expertise, and calibration enable a precision of ± 0.04% of full scale, exceptional repeatability (< 0.01%), and long-term stability (static accuracy: 0.04%). The construction is also nearly insensitive to eccentric loads (< 0.1% / cm) and transverse forces (< 0.25%), and highly robust, with an overload protection of 150%.

The operating temperature range is -55 to 90°C. Temperature compensation is applied between -10 and 45°C.

Installation

  • Bridge supply: 1-20 VDC

  • Installation 1: Tension only. The load is applied via a spherical rod end + nut. Sensor installation with base when the mounting surface has imperfections (see accessories). Screw types, tightening torques here
  • Installation 2: Compression only. The load is applied to the measurement surface. Sensor installation with base when the mounting surface has imperfections (see accessories). Screw types, tightening torques here
  • Installation 3: Tension/compression. The load is applied via a threaded rod + nut. Sensor installation directly on the surface. Screw types, tightening torques here
  • Installation 4: Compression only. The load is applied to the measurement surface. Sensor installation directly on the surface. Screw types, tightening torques here
  • Installation 5: Tension/compression, in-line, with base and rod ends on both sides of the sensor. Screw types, tightening torques here

Signal Conditioning and Acquisition

The output signal of the 3200 series sensors is unamplified. It is possible to obtain a complete measurement chain, wired and configured specifically for the application, by integrating a Display, an Analog signal conditioner/amplifier with voltage or current output, or a Data acquisition system for PC or PLC with included acquisition software.
